Oncology Data Specialist – Associate

atSavistaRemoteUS flagUnited StatesFull-timeUncategorizedJuniorMid-level$24 – $27/hour

Posted Jun 9

This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in United States.

📋 Description

• Engage in both new hire and annual Quality reviews, conducted either onsite or remotely.

• Take part in monthly departmental conference calls and client meetings, which may involve presenting educational topics and trends related to Oncology.

• Maintain certification and membership with NCRA, in addition to relevant state association memberships.

• Contribute to Savista’s Compliance Program by following policies and procedures related to HIPAA, FDCPA, FCRA, and other applicable laws governing Savista’s business practices.

• Collaborate with the QA Team to fulfill all assigned tasks.

• Consistently achieve an abstracting accuracy rate of 95%.

• Meet an abstracting productivity standard of 1.55 hours per case.

• Complete weekly productivity reports and finalize time cards at the conclusion of each workweek.

• Provide required data to the State Central Registry and National Cancer Data Base upon manager's request.


⛳️ Requirements

• High school diploma or GED is required.

• Certification as a Tumor Registrar (ODS-C) and active membership in the national and/or local cancer registrar association.

• At least 2 years of abstracting experience or attainment of ODS-C or ODS-Cs with 2+ years of abstracting experience alongside a non-passing score on the Abstractor PET Exam.

• Proficiency with STORES and AJCC Staging is mandatory.

• Familiarity with all 2018 data collection changes across all standard setters.

• Recent experience in abstracting that meets established productivity standards and accuracy benchmarks.

• Effective communication skills in diverse settings, including interactions with colleagues, medical staff, and other departments within the facility.

• Competence in MS Office applications, including Word, Excel, and PowerPoint.

• Capability to utilize various email and Internet applications.

• A college degree or a degree in an allied health field is preferred; completion of courses in Medical Terminology, Anatomy, and Physiology is required.

• Must demonstrate exceptional interpersonal and problem-solving abilities with all levels of internal and external customers.

• Traveling Registry Associates must have the ability to travel without restrictions.
